Why Scalable Vector Graphics Matter in Practice
The “SVG” in Snorkelling SVG cut file stands for Scalable Vector Graphic—a format built on mathematical paths rather than pixels. This means no quality loss when resizing, rotating, or mirroring. In real-world use, that translates to reliability: a single file serves multiple output needs without requiring redesign or re-exporting. For example, an educator preparing ocean-themed science materials can use the same Snorkelling SVG cut file to create vinyl decals for lab equipment labels, layered felt cutouts for interactive bulletin boards, and printable tracing sheets—all from one source. There’s no need to manage separate high-res and low-res versions, and no risk of jagged edges when the design is enlarged for wall displays.

Customization Without Compromise
Unlike static PNG overlays or pre-colored clipart, a Snorkelling SVG cut file retains full editability in compatible software (e.g., Cricut Design Space, Silhouette Studio, Adobe Illustrator, or Inkscape). You can adjust stroke weight, separate layers for multi-color cutting, recolor individual elements to match brand palettes, or combine it with other SVG assets to build complex scenes—say, pairing the snorkel icon with coral, fish, or wave motifs. Because color data is stored as editable attributes—not embedded pixels—you avoid banding, dithering, or muddy gradients when changing hues. Quality and Consistency Across Outputs
Well-constructed Snorkelling SVG cut files follow vector best practices: minimal anchor points, clean path direction, properly grouped layers, and no embedded raster elements. When sourced from reputable creators, they include both “cut-only” and “score-and-cut” variants, accommodate registration marks for multi-layer alignment, and avoid problematic overlaps or tiny disconnected fragments that cause cutting errors. In testing across machines, files meeting these standards consistently produced accurate cuts on 60-micron vinyl and 2mm craft foam—no misfeeds, skipped lines, or unintended interior cuts. Limitations to Acknowledge
While versatile, the Snorkelling SVG cut file isn’t universally plug-and-play. Its performance depends on three factors outside the file itself: machine calibration, material feed stability, and software interpretation. Some older Silhouette models may require manual node adjustment if the original SVG uses advanced features like compound paths or gradient meshes. Also, intricate details—like fine snorkel tube textures or delicate fin perforations—may not translate cleanly to thicker materials like leather or balsa without simplification. Users should preview cut previews before committing to expensive stock, and consider simplifying paths in vector editors when working with low-TPI blades or high-speed cutting modes.
